Studio One Roots 2

Studio One / Soul Jazz

Staggering. Beautifully paced and varied, this classic compilation hasn’t aged a bit. Killer after killer, including numerous sides out here for the first time.

‘Vol 1 was mighty fine, presenting rare and deep recordings from Studio One’s mid-70s heyday. Hard to believe the Vol 2 is even better… As with all Soul Jazz material, the vinyl is heavyweight, with fine packaging and good liner notes. Reggae music doesn’t get much better than this: buy immediately and play loud’ (David Katz, Fact).
‘This will be hard to beat in the Studio One series in my humble opinion, amazing stuff. Too many good tunes on here to pick. Check this out you will not be disappointed’ (RYM).
‘Soul Jazz still crank out the best. Non-completist, non-purist, but always 100% killer’ (Mojo).
‘If anything, Studio One Roots 2 is even better than the first volume and has some superb (and rare) tracks’ (Record Collector).

Studio One Funk

Studio One / Soul Jazz

Chocka with scorchers.
Isaac Hayes, Booker T, Stevie Wonder, and James Brown are in the house.
Some of the previously unreleased cuts are amazing, like the spaghetti-western Jackie Mittoo, and The Sharks’ dread techno.
Clear vinyl.
